## Environment Variables — SDK Parity Harness

The parity harness runs the Lattice client SDKs (Kotlin and Swift) against the same fixture server and diffs responses. Reviewers should confirm both SDK containers read the same env file, /opt/parity/harness.env. PARITY_MODE, FIXTURE_PORT, and DIFF_FORMAT are non-sensitive and may appear in CI logs. The harness also authenticates to the fixture server with a shared credential, which must stay out of logs and diffs. That credential's line is appended directly below.

secret setting of yagef-baweg: RELAY_SECRET29=cb53deb59a49ed54d9f43599b54ca

Ticket: Unlock migration vault for Ironvine ORM refactor

New team members: the legacy Ironvine ORM layer is being replaced module by module, and the schema snapshots needed for safe refactoring sit in a locked vault nobody has opened since the last owner left. We recovered the credentials from escrow this week. The passphrase follows below.

unlock words, kajog-yawip: istwyn-casath-aldok

**Q: How does RestockRanger decide which vending machines get refilled first?**

Good question — it trips up everyone at first. RestockRanger scores each machine nightly using sales velocity, distance from the Farrowdale depot, and a "grumpiness" factor based on recent out-of-stock complaints. Top-scoring machines land on the next morning's route sheet. You can't manually bump a machine (tempting, we know) without an override ticket. The full scoring formula and override process are documented here.

wiki page, tahaf-tajog: https://jira.ordindyn.corp/pipeline

// Fan-out backpressure for the Norrell notification bus.
// Plugin authors: deliveries to your hook are queued per subscriber;
// when your queue passes the high-water mark we pause dispatch and
// retry with jittered backoff. Slow consumers past the stall budget
// are shed, not buffered forever — handle redelivery idempotently.
// These limits are enforced host-side and cannot be overridden from
// plugin manifests. The enforced constants are defined below.

tuning table, yajog-yahof:
BUDGETS = {
    "lamvan": 303,
    "wenox": 460,
    "fenvan": 525,
}